Ingredients Quantity
For the Chicken Bake
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 large yellow onions, thinly sliced
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
Additional Ingredients (Recommended)
- 1 cup beef broth
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- ½ teaspoon dried thyme
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
- 1½ cups shredded Gruyère, Swiss, or mozzarella cheese

Tips for Success
- Caramelize the onions slowly for the best flavor.
- Use evenly sized chicken breasts for consistent cooking.
- Avoid overcrowding the skillet when cooking onions.
- Let the chicken rest for a few minutes before serving.
- Broil briefly at the end for a golden cheese topping.
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 190°C (375°F).
- Season the chicken breasts with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and thyme.
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
- Add the sliced onions and cook for 20–25 minutes, stirring occasionally, until deeply golden and caramelized.
- Add the beef broth and simmer for 2–3 minutes.
- Transfer the chicken breasts to a greased baking dish.
- Spoon the onion mixture evenly over the chicken.
- Cover with shredded cheese.
- Bake for 25–30 minutes, or until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 74°C (165°F).
- Broil for 2–3 minutes if desired for extra browning.
- Garnish with parsley and serve.
